I know some of you thought that the Casino Nova Scotia gig was “Every Song Tells a Story” as it turns out it is actually an outdoor, 90 minute Rock Show. I came prepared to play ESTAS which is why I’ll be using my big black Yamaha guitar tonight. Normally for rock shows I use my smaller red Yamaha AES600.

Randy played with Burton Cummings last night in St. John Newfoundland and says that Burton is singing pretty good and is 5 weeks into a health program. I look forward to seeing him Vancouver very soon at the River Rock.

The view from the side of the stage is the Halifax harbour. The water is teeming with sailboats this long weekend. It sure is beautiful here in the summer. I’ve got 30 minutes to get ready for the show. The set we are going to play is the one I created in Corpus Christi, Texas for the Harley-Davidson corporate show. We added some Guess Who rockers, like Albert Flasher and Bus Rider to get the place rockin and we’ll open with Let it Ride.
